Illawarra Primary School (PS) is seeking to appoint a reliable and enthusiastic individual to join their school support team in the role of Gardener – Handyperson.
The successful applicant will be responsible for the maintenance of our school grounds and complete minor repairs and maintenance jobs in accordance with the Department’s policies and guidelines. We are seeking an individual who is hardworking, enthusiastic, energetic, has a passion for gardening and turf management, is able to follow instructions and work collaboratively and independently when needed. Ideally the successful applicant has good communication and interpersonal skills and works well with others and have the ability to identify and recognise work that is required to be completed without specific direction.
Experience in a school or other large grounds as well as working knowledge of gardening machinery and reticulation is also necessary. Our grounds are extensive and require ongoing maintenance. The successful applicant will need to perform tasks and duties using safe work practices and maintain accurate gardening records.
Illawarra PS is an Independent Public School located in the suburb of Ballajura, approximately 17 kilometres north of the Perth CBD. Our location is on a regular public transport route and close to shops and medical centres. A before and after-school care facility for students from Kindergarten to Year 6 is offered on the grounds of Illawarra Primary School and is run by Camp Australia.
The school is located on well-established grounds with excellent facilities including basketball courts, tennis courts, performing arts stage with lighting and sound, and a variety of play equipment engaging children in social play.

Eligibility and Training Requirements
Employees will be required to:
- Provide evidence of eligibility to work in Australia for the term of the vacancy;
- Complete introductory School Gardener training within 3 months of commencement in metropolitan areas or as soon as practicable for regional areas;
- Complete the Department’s induction program within three months of commencement;
- Complete any training specific to this role required by Departmental policy;
- Obtain a current Department of Education Criminal Record Clearance prior to commencement of employment;
- Obtain or hold a current Working with Children Check;
- Complete the Department’s training in Accountable and Ethical Decision-Making within six months of appointment.
